Job Description

 in Odessa, Texas. This is a permanent, full-time position dedicated to providing exemplary emergency care within a dynamic, Level 2 trauma center. The ideal candidate will be committed to delivering quality patient outcomes in a collaborative environment while enjoying opportunities for professional growth and career advancement.

Key Responsibilities
• Provide comprehensive emergency medical coverage across all age groups, managing a high-volume, fast-paced emergency department.
• Conduct thorough patient assessments, establish diagnoses, and implement appropriate treatment plans efficiently.
• Collaborate with a multidisciplinary team, including trauma surgeons, hospitalists, pediatric hospitalists, specialists, and ancillary staff, to ensure seamless patient care.
• Utilize Cerner FirstNet EMR with Dragon dictation, leveraging efficient order sets and streamlined charting processes to optimize workflow.
• Participate in patient stabilization, minor procedures, and critical interventions as required.
• Assist in the management of trauma cases, including admissions for operative pelvic fractures, burns, strokes requiring thrombectomy, and pediatric ICU admissions.
• Support mental health evaluations, with protocols in place for admissions when psychiatric facilities are at capacity.
• Maintain compliance with hospital policies, participate in quality improvement initiatives, and contribute to a positive work environment.

Qualifications:
• Board Certification or Eligibility in Emergency Medicine by the American Board of Emergency Medicine (ABEM) or equivalent.
• Open to summer 2025 graduates with appropriate training.
• Prior experience in a Level 2 trauma setting preferred but not mandatory.
• Excellent clinical judgment, communication skills, and teamwork ethic.
• Ability to work 10-hour shifts, averaging approximately 2.0-2.2 patients per hour.
• Comfortable working with electronic health records, including Cerner FirstNet EMR system.
• Valid Texas medical license or eligibility to obtain one.

Benefits and Opportunities:
• Competitive productivity-based compensation, with hourly earnings averaging over $325.
• 40 hours of physician coverage alongside dedicated mid-level provider coverage.
• Full access to hospital resources, including 24/7 on-site ED pharmacists, CT scanners, ultrasound machines, and MRI.
• Connection with academic programs through Texas Tech, offering teaching and research opportunities.
• Partnership potential for qualified physicians interested in long-term stability and community integration.
• Minimal boarding issues, efficient patient flow, and streamlined admissions process.
• Supportive work environment with comprehensive call coverage and in-house trauma surgeons available 24/7.
• Renowned Texas Tech affiliation fostering professional development and continued education.
